The big problem here is that no one actually really knows just how much vitamin D is necessary. So their claims of X units per day recommended are just as bogus as those claiming 2X or 3X.
Until we can actually figure out just where all that vit D is supposed to be used in the body, we're just making it up.
(It should be noted that this study only seems concerned with bone growth-- something we are not sure of yet is vitamin D's only function)
